33 Life Is Like a Bike Quotes to Fuel Your Journey

To help you get started on this journey of self-discovery and growth, we’ve curated a list of 33 inspiring quotes that explore the theme of “life is like a bike.” From thought leaders and athletes to philosophers and everyday people, these quotes offer a diverse range of perspectives on what it means to live life to the fullest.

  1. “Life is like riding a bicycle. To keep your balance, you must keep moving.” – Albert Einstein
  2. “The journey of a thousand miles begins with a single pedal stroke.” – Unknown
  3. “Fall seven times, stand up eight.” – Japanese proverb
  4. “You can’t start the next chapter of your life if you keep re-reading the last one.” – Unknown
  5. “The road goes ever on and on, down from the door where it began.” – J.R.R. Tolkien
  6. “It’s not about being the best; it’s about being better than you were yesterday.” – Unknown
  7. “Life begins at the end of your comfort zone.” – Neale Donald Walsch
  8. “You don’t have to be great to start, but you have to start to be great.” – Zig Ziglar
  9. “The only way to do great work is to love what you do.” – Steve Jobs
  10. “Ride as much or as little, or as long or as short as you feel. But ride.” – Unknown
  11. “The biggest risk is not taking any risk…” – Mark Zuckerberg
  12. “You are never too old to set another goal or to dream a new dream.” – C.S. Lewis
  13. “The best way to get started is to quit talking and begin doing.” – Walt Disney
  14. “Keep your eyes on the stars, and your feet on the ground.” – Theodore Roosevelt
  15. “Do something today that your future self will thank you for.” – Unknown
  16. “The greatest glory in living lies not in never falling, but in rising every time we fall.” – Nelson Mandela
  17. “You miss 100% of the shots you don’t take.” – Wayne Gretzky
  18. “I don’t count my sit-ups. I only start counting when it starts burning.” – Muhammad Ali
  19. “You don’t have to control your thoughts. You just have to stop letting them control you.” – Dan Millman
  20. “Life is 10% what happens to you and 90% how you react to it.” – Charles R. Swindoll
  21. “You are stronger than you seem, braver than you believe, and smarter than you think.” – Christopher Robin
  22. “Don’t watch the clock; do what it does. Keep going.” – Sam Levenson
  23. “The only limit to our realization of tomorrow will be our doubts of today.” – Franklin D. Roosevelt
  24. “You can’t go back and change the beginning, but you can start where you are and change the ending.” – C.S. Lewis
  25. “It always seems impossible until it’s done.” – Nelson Mandela
  26. “The biggest adventure you can take is to live the life of your dreams.” – Oprah Winfrey
  27. “You don’t get what you wish for, you get what you work for.” – Daniel Milstein
  28. “Ride your bike, eat your veggies, and don’t be a jerk.” – Unknown
  29. “The journey is the reward.” – Chinese proverb
  30. “You are the master of your fate; you are the captain of your soul.” – William Ernest Henley
  31. “Don’t be afraid to take the road less traveled.” – Robert Frost
  32. “Life is not about waiting for the storm to pass; it’s about learning to dance in the rain.” – Vivian Greene
  33. “The best view comes after the hardest climb.” – Unknown
